On September 15, local time, British Prime Minister Johnson reorganized his cabinet.

The most interesting thing in this reorganization is the change of the foreign minister.

  At the time when the situation in Afghanistan changed suddenly, the former Minister of Foreign Affairs Raab went to Greece for vacation, but failed to end the vacation and return to work in time.

Coupled with a series of chaos in the British withdrawal from Afghanistan, Raab has been criticized by the outside world.

  According to reports, according to the latest survey by the market research agency YouGov, Prime Minister Johnson’s approval rating has also fallen from 48% in May to 35%.
